| Re: 04 v6 looking for supercharger or turbo
Anybody and I mean Anybody with a set of hand tools, and the reading comprehension of an 8th grader can install almost anything on a car. Save yourself money and do installs your self. Now gears, and internal work is more advanced and you may not wanna mess with that.
Anyway TMA's cheapest turbo kit is about $3,200 and should take you a weekend to install. As with anything your going to need bigger fuel injectors, a fuel pump, and a dyno tune so average about 7-900$ more onto your tab. You can find used s/c kits sometimes from 1800-2500$ on 3.8mustang/v6power.net
The supercoupe m90 is a big headache if you have a 99-04 you have to convert back to single port heads, plus the super coupe motor was built to withstand the heat and the blower our bottom end is not.

| Re: 04 v6 looking for supercharger or turbo
turbo will make more power easier~ the limit seems to be 340-400rwhp~ if you are in that range you need a great tune and you should be ok... but you simply never know.
Some do the M112 from the 03/04 cobra and get around 300rwhp without to much hassle~ the kit is non intercooled and overall its a nice setup~ just cant run your stock hood with it.
A turbo kit will cost you much more but make better power in the end~ and a vortech or procharger also will make around 300rwhp at 12-14psi~ and are warrantied~ and fit under the stock hood. A turbo will make that power much lower in boost though.
all of these numbers are quoted for manuals trans, the auto sucks about 7 more percent from em.

| Re: 04 v6 looking for supercharger or turbo Quote:
Originally Posted by SerbStang When I say "install" I don't mean blower, hoses, and such...it's more injectors, fuel pump, some electronics and chips I have, gauges, than moving the a/c lines ...! That's what i don't like! | Its simple: Easy way for a/c line discharge it (the right or wrong way) have take it apart have them cut it and weld -an fittings then use braided hose and their you go new ac line. injectors just snap in make sure the o rings aren't damaged, fuel pump drop tank pull out (don't remember think it was 2 Phillips heads?) drop new one in put tank back in place bolt it up make sure you get a fuel filler pipe grommet from ford your 90% gonna own yours. take it to the dyno shop they will handle the rest.
